I have a crocodile roller. I want to just have a hint of texture , kinda leathery look..can i do a the same color wall with the positive imprint of the same color paint ?
@ArtisticPaintingStudio
@ArtisticPaintingStudio 4 жыл бұрын
If you are looking for a more random not continuous print, you could roll the same color. But realize that you will barely see this. Also, best way to use the red colors in a positive application is to use a serving tray lined with press-n-seal, brush the paint onto the lined tray and then roll the roller through the wet paint, this way it's only picking up the paint on the raised design. and then roll onto your surface - but this will only go about 12 to 18 inches and then you will have to reload once again.
